MPSC503WEAXX2A Eaton: Eaton Magnum low voltage power circuit breaker, Magnum PXR, Double standard frame, 5000 A (ABCABC), 100 kA, Three-pole, Drawout vertical mounting, PXR20 LSI trip unit
Product Name
Eaton Magnum low voltage power circuit breaker
Catalog Number
MPSC503WEAXX2A
UPC
786689630881
Product Length/Depth
16.3 in
Product Height
16.8 in
Product Width
31.1 in
Product Weight
237 lb
Compliances
NEMA Compliant SABA Listed CCC Marked CE Marked
Certifications
ANSI UL Listed KEMA Certified Lloyd's Register Certified CSA Certified DNV GL Certified ABS Certified
